Transaction 5c6157634c660178cd172dc667e2252944a0f2f5c6565c22926249ac66080ff3

2 Input
2 Outputs
  • 5c6157634c660178cd172dc667e2252944a0f2f5c6565c22926249ac66080ff3:0
  • value  700000000
    address  12NaNdewoiGcaSAXAmYqfJc6NrkDTzxz1y
  • 5c6157634c660178cd172dc667e2252944a0f2f5c6565c22926249ac66080ff3:1
  • value  50750525
    address  1KWrx1iHJR8WWaXofvjd7Uv5ikw3Ejf2ay